Assistive home care offers the luxury of many services that can be administered in the comfort of your own home. Typically, home care providers review potential clients before admittance. This screening might include ADLs abilities, medication use, and health problems. This care type offers multiple services including local transportation, assistance scheduling medical appointments, and laundry. This type of care can provide various medical services including retrieving medication from secured storage, aid in self-administration of medication, and opening container lids. Furthermore, services provided will comprise help with household chores and ventilator care. Senior home care may also afford your loved one help with diet choices and with meal preparation. Finally, senior home care can support your loved one with services including transfers from wheelchair to bed and assistance with ambulation.
The rent burden for Belton is about 17.2% of the average person’s monthly income. Monthly, the median rent in Belton is around $982 and the median value of a home in Belton costs around $124,543.
In Belton, 10.0% live in poverty, 70.7% participate in the labor force, 14.8% have some form of disability, and 5.8% consider themselves widows. Belton has a population density of 641 people per square mile. The total population of Belton consists of 23,480 people. Demographically, Belton is 1.6% Asian, 0.0% Pacific Islander or Native Hawaiian, 2.9% mixed race, 9.4% Hispanic, 4.5% black, 0.5% Native American, 1.4% other or not specified, and 89.0% white. Out of the total city population, 49.9% are female and 50.1% are male. The median age of Belton is 35 years old. In Belton, 11.9% of the people are veterans of the United States military. In terms of education, 35.4% have a high-school diploma, 5.9% have a graduate degree, and 19.2% have a college degree.
Overall, Missouri ranks 28th out of all states in quality of life and 41st in healthcare. In total, Missouri has 128 general hospitals and 212 health centers that provide care for 6,144,344 citizens. Mosaic Life Care At St Joseph, Mercy Hospital St Louis, and Mercy Hospital Springfield are among the top three highest ranked hospitals in the state. Residents of Missouri enjoy its natural beauty which ranks 9th in the United States. In terms of resources, Missouri has a cost of living index of 88.8, a grocery index rating of 96.6, and a housing index rating of 70.6. These index ratings are based on a system where 100 is considered the national average and anything below 100 is considered less expensive than the national average.
In Missouri, 30% of the population is over the age of 55. The median age in the state is 39. In the last presidential election 38% of Missouri residents voted Democrat and 57% voted Republican. The state of Missouri ranks 35th in the country for diversity. In terms of religion, 37% of Missouri residents attend religious services among the 9,001 different congregations that are available in the state. The top three non-Christian denominations in the state are Jewish-<1%, Muslim-<1%, and Buddhist-<1%, with the most common Christian denominations consisting of Evangelical Protestant-36%, Mainline Protestant-16%, and Historically Black Protestant-6%. In Missouri there are 414 masonic lodges.
The average monthly precipitation for the state of Missouri is around 3.63 inches. The most precipitation occurs in June with an average of 6.57 inches of precipitation a month. The average humidity across the state is 69%. Humidity levels tend to reach their peak in the month of December at around 75%. The average air quality index rating in Missouri is 37.3 AQI. The average air quality index rating peaks in the month of May with a rating of around 48.7 AQI. The average temperature in the winter falls to around 33F. During the winter, the average high temperature peaks at around 51F during the month of February. The average low temperature during the winter drops to around 12F in the month of January. During the summer, the average temperature in Missouri is around 76F. The average high summer temperature is around 92F in the month of July. In the summer, the average low temperature drops to around 57F during the month of June. While residents of Missouri mostly enjoy pleasant conditions, it’s important to be aware of inclement weather as well, which in Missouri can include floods, earthquakes (moderate), and tornadoes.
The state of Missouri has a diverse array of plant and animal life. Local plant life can consist of smooth brome, scouring rush, wild grape, and poison ivy. While venturing throughout the state, you might see animals such as the silver-haired bat , the long-tailed weasel, the red fox, or the cougar. The state animal of Missouri is the the mule.
